Overview of Blues Rock musician The Harpoonist & The Axe Murderer
The Blues-Rock combo The Harpoonist & The Axe Murderer is from Vancouver, Canada. Their sound is a fusion of traditional electric blues, gospel, and rock 'n' roll with a contemporary touch. The raw, gritty vocals of the pair and the harmonica's deep cry define their sound.
Their music reflects their blues roots while also having a modern edge that makes them stand out from other Blues-Rock groups. The Harpoonist & The Axe Murderer are renowned for their exuberant live shows and their capacity to enthrall crowds with their contagious rhythms and memorable hooks.

What are the latest songs and music albums for Blues Rock musician The Harpoonist & The Axe Murderer?
The Vancouver, Canada-based blues rock band The Harpoonist & The Axe Murderer will release their most recent CD, "Live at the King Eddy," in 2022. The album's 11 live tracks, which were captured at Calgary's famous King Edward Hotel, showcase the group's exuberant stage presence and unprocessed sound. The album is a must-listen for aficionados of blues rock music with songs like "Mama's in the Backseat," "Don't Make 'Em Like They Used To," and "Gone Digital."
The group issued a number of singles in 2021, among them "Pretty Please (Live)," "Father's Son, Pt. 1," and "Forever Fool." These songs, which have catchy tunes and enduring lyrics, highlight the band's distinctive fusion of blues, rock, and soulful vocals. Another excellent song that highlights the group's skill at writing catchy blues rock songs is "Hard on Things," which was published in 2018.
